Forget mailshot drops or Google Adwords to advertise your latest property listings or awards, one agent has turned to the high street and his own face to promote his brand.

Paul Cooney, director of London agent Horton and Garton in Chiswick, has rented an LED advertising board on Chiswick High Road showing just his face and a positive customer review.

Cooney said there is too much “puff” about sales figures in agency advertising, when sellers actually want to know about service.

He said: “I could say ‘we’re number one for sales agreed in Chiswick, Hammersmith and Shepherds Bush’ in huge letters but frankly no one cares.

“People are so used to agents’ puffery that it’s impossible for them to separate the genuine claim from the exaggerated.

“Chiswickians want to know how I will work for them as most people have had at least one shocking experience with an estate agent.

“The service I offer is unparalleled and the best in west London so that’s what I needed to capture in the ad.

“Ultimately, it’s about the client – so several of my past and current clients have agreed to share their testimonials on the LED board in the coming months.

“The response I’ve had thus far after only one week has been overwhelming with one local lady telling me every time she sees the ad it makes her smile.

“Ultimately, that’s what we’re here to do – make sellers and buyers happy by turning a stressful experience into an enjoyable one.”
